New Zealand Association of Event Professionals The New Zealand Association of Event Professionals (NZAEP) is an incorporated society established in 2005 for the purpose of being the industry association for event professionals in New Zealand. It was formed in response to industry demand for a recognised body to represent the burgeoning events industry in New Zealand. The mission of the Association is to provide leadership for the industry through advocacy, education and accreditation. NZAEP members who have successfully gained NZAEP accreditation are recognised as event professionals within the industry who are committed to ethical business practice. Volunteering New Zealand Volunteering New Zealand (VNZ) is an association of regional volunteer centres and national organisations with a strong commitment to volunteering. These organisations cover emergency services, health, welfare, education, culture, faith based services, community support, ethnic groups, sport and recreation, conservation, special interests, advocacy and international volunteering. VNZ is the voice for volunteering in New Zealand and its mission is to create an environment which supports, promotes, values and encourages effective volunteering by all New Zealanders.
